Close-up

The roof on a vacant 1950s gas station in Portsmouth, N.H., was key to transforming the structure into a bustling bagel shop.

Demolition would have triggered costly zoning requirements, so the project team decided to reroof the structure with GAF’s EverGuard® PVC system with polyisocyanurate insulation and a vapor retarder.

KTM Exteriors & Recycling LLC, a female-owned, GAF GoldElite™ and CoatingsPro+™ certified contractor in Hampstead, N.H., installed the 3,700-square-foot roof system. The Getty Bagel Shop is now a local favorite, blending nostalgia with innovation.
